Crime Writers of Color (CWoC) is an association of authors seeking to present a strong and united voice for members who self-identify as crime/mystery writers from traditionally underrepresented racial, cultural and ethnic backgrounds. CWoC has no bylaws or elected officers and is not a nonprofit or any other form of legal entity, but an ad hoc and informal group. Though no group speaks for all of its individual participants, CWoC’s mission is to speak out based on its assessment of the collective views of its membership. Opinions expressed by individuals are their own.
